Determining the Right Mirror Size for Various Vanity Widths

Choosing the right mirror size based on your vanity width is crucial for achieving balance and functionality in your bathroom. Whether you have a 24 inch vanity, a 36 inch vanity, or even a 72 inch vanity, the bathroom mirror size calculator can help you find the perfect mirror size to fit your vanity and your bathroom design.

24 Inch Vanity

What Size Mirror for a 24 Inch Vanity: For smaller vanities, you’ll want a mirror that’s slightly smaller than the vanity. A mirror 20 inches wide is generally safe. This size provides enough mirrors to see your face, but not so much that you can see the back of your head. You could consider using a magnifying mirror with light or a backlit bathroom mirror for added functionality and style.

36 Inch Vanity

What Size Mirror for a 36 Inch Vanity: Look for a mirror that is approximately 28-30 inches wide for a 36 inch vanity. This size will provide plenty of mirror space for your reflection while maintaining the proportion with your vanity.

42 Inch Vanity

What Size Mirror for a 42 Inch Vanity: Since your vanity is 42 inches wide, you’ll want a mirror that is approximately 34-36 inches wide. This size will give you enough mirror space and will look proportionate on the larger vanity.

60 Inch Vanity

What Size Mirror for a 60 Inch Vanity: For a 60 inch vanity, you’re going to want to look for a mirror that is about 48-50 inches wide. This large mirror will look fantastic on the larger vanity and will give you that grand look you’re likely wanting.

72 Inch Vanity

Mirror Size for 72 Inch Vanity: With a 72 inch vanity, you’re going to want me to look for a mirror that is about 60 inches wide. This gives you an approximately equal amount of space on the sides of the vanity and creates a visually appealing space.

Round Mirrors

Round Mirror Size Guide: Round mirrors are very classy and add a soft, elegant touch to any bathroom. The nice thing about a round mirror is that they look good in a small bathroom and a large bathroom. But to pick the right size, you can use a round mirror size guide to pick the right size you need to go with your vanity and make your bathroom look good.

What Size Round Mirror for 48 Inch Vanity: If your vanity is 48 inches, look for a round mirror around 36 inches in diameter. It gives you plenty of space to see yourself but provides that balanced look on your 48 inch vanity.

Rectangular Mirrors

Rectangular Bathroom Mirror Size Calculator: Rectangular mirrors are very classic. A rectangular mirror will work in pretty much any bathroom style. You can use a rectangular bathroom mirror size calculator and get the right size for your vanity or your double vanity.

What Size Mirror for a 36 Vanity: If you have a 36 inch vanity, look for a 36 inch mirror. Something around 28-30 inches wide would be great because you get a good bit of reflection on your mirror and it keeps it proportional to your vanity.

Oval Mirrors

Choosing an Oval Mirror Size: Oval mirrors offer a blend of round and rectangular shapes, adding a touch of  sophistication to the bathroom. Choosing the right size is a balance of how it looks  with your vanity as well as how it fits within the space.

Optimal Size for Various Vanities: Depending on the width of your vanity, you’ll want to make sure your  oval mirror is properly sized to create balance. A 36” vanity will look great  with a 28” wide oval mirror. However, a larger vanity would look better  with a bigger oval mirror to create harmony in your bathroom.
